Key Responsibilities
As the Assistant Research, Planning, Monitoring & Evaluation Officer, you will:
- Assist in the design and development of monitoring and evaluation frameworks, tools, and methodologies.
- Collect, analyze, and interpret educational data to support planning, policy development, and decision-making.
- Prepare research reports, performance reports, and analytical briefs for management.
- Support the implementation of research, planning, and strategic initiatives across the organization.
- Monitor and evaluate curriculum implementation and educational programmes to assess effectiveness and impact.
- Compile, manage, and maintain accurate research and monitoring data.
- Assist in conducting surveys, field studies, and other research activities.
- Perform any other duties assigned in support of the Directorate’s objectives.
